Kevin B. Farley, 42

Kevin B. Farley, 42, of Lancaster died unexpectedly on Friday, January 1, 2010. He was the loving husband of Lisa M. Grammatico Farley for 20 years and devoted father of Tim, Mike and Julianna Farley, all of Lancaster. Born in Queens, NY, he was the son of John R. Farley of Exton, PA and Virginia Conboy Farley of Endwell, NY. Kevin’s family also includes his brother John Farley of Levittown, NY.

Kevin graduated from East Meadow High School in Long Island, NY, where is enshrined in the Football Hall of Fame. He attended Nassau Community College in Long Island, where he also played football. An offensive guard, Kevin tried out for the NY Jets, surviving until the second round of cuts.

A hard working entrepreneur, Kevin was a self employed fence installer. He was a member of St. John Neumann Catholic Church in Lancaster. Kevin loved motor sports, working on cars and he was an avid outdoorsman. Sports, especially football, were a major part of his life. He enjoyed watching his kids participate in sports and taking them on fun weekend adventures. His main purpose was to provide for his family. Kevin’s legacy will continue on through Tim, Mike and Julianna.

A Mass of Christian Burial will take place Wednesday, January 6th at 11 AM from St. John Neumann Catholic Church, 601 Delp Road, Lancaster, PA with The Rev. Paul J. Theisz as Celebrant. Visitations will take place on Tuesday from 5-8 PM and also on Wednesday from 9:30 to 10:30 AM, both at the Charles F. Snyder Funeral Home & Chapel, Inc. 3110 Lititz Pike, Lititz, PA. Interment in Landis Valley Mennonite Cemetery. Please omit flowers. To send online condolences please visit snyderfuneralhome.com
